6 // Return a monotonically increasing 64-bit clock value that wraps
7 // around no more often than once per year, and with a resolution of 1
8 // us or better (if possible). This function's availability and
9 // privileged status is architecture and configuration dependent; on
10 // x86 and x64, it is normally not privileged. On some architectures,
11 // and on older (486 and earlier) x86 chips, it will need to be
12 // supplied externally using board or kernel specific code.
14 static inline int64_t ll_getclock()
19 asm volatile("rdtsc" : "=a" (low), "=d" (high));
21 return ((int64_t)high << 32) | low;
